This semester, the PRH Expansion Project was developed as part of COMSTRAT 383 with Rebecca Cooney, where my team and I developed a full integrated marketing communications plan for Pullman Regional Hospital’s 2026 Expansion Project. This work challenges us to think strategically across research, messaging, audience segmentation, and community engagement, all centered on enhancing access to high‑quality healthcare in the Palouse.

My primary role within the project has been developing the Digital Asset Brief, which focuses on creating clear, visually engaging tools that support transparency and strengthen community trust in the expansion. I’m working on the design of concepts for two key assets: a real‑time Expansion Progress & Impact Dashboard, and a Before‑and‑After Visualization Series that illustrates how the new facilities will improve high‑demand clinical spaces. These assets help donors, patients, and community members understand the purpose, progress, and long‑term impact of the expansion.
